alien keyring1 / 6
alien keyring
alien keyring
alien keyring
alien keyring
alien keyring
alien keyring

alien keyring

42931580
$31
No additional charges except shipping fee
100% Authentic

Product ID

42931580

Measurements

Size
FREE

You may also like